It should probably be 6 Sep 2000-cw] Carl L. Daniel Carl L. Daniel, Age 80 and a resident of Franklinton, died at 2:30 PM Tuesday, August 29, 2000 at his son’s residence. He was a retired carpenter. He is survived by three sons, John Louis Daniel and Larry Gene Daniel, both of Franklinton, and Jimmie Carl Daniel of Franklin, LA. Also survived by one sister, Margaret Mixon of Atlanta, GA, eight grandchildren and 13 great-grandchildren. Visitation was at Crain Funeral Home from 5 PM until 9 PM Wednesday and after 8 AM Thursday. A funeral services was held at 10:00 AM Thursday in the Funeral Home Chapel with the Rev. Terry McCain and the Rev. Rick Wood officiating. Pallbearers were Jeff Daniel, Gilbert Spears, Jimmie Daniel II, Greg Ibert, Mike Daniel and Johnnie Daniel Jr. Burial was in the Bankston Cemetery at Mt. Hermon. Robert C. Johnson Robert C. Johnson, age 73, and a resident of Pine, LA, died at 1:40 PM Sunday, August 27 at Riverside Medical Center in Franklinton. He was a retied accountant and business consultant. Johnson is survived by his wife, Elizabeth Oalmann Johnson of Pine; one son, Don Johnson of Bogalusa; two daughters, Elizabeth Adkin of Enon, LA, and Andrea Lake of Washington State. Also survived by two granddaughters and one grandson. Crain Funeral Home was in charge of the arrangements. Frank Thomas Nelson Frank Thomas Nelson, 57, a native of Tallahassee, FL, and longtime resident of the Clifton Community, died on Thursday, August 31 at Veterans Hospital in Biloxi, MS. He is survived by his wife, Sara Bateman Nelson, of Clifton, a daughter and son-in-law, Hilaria Nelson Broadwater and Chris Broadwater of Hammond; his mother, Ruby Grace McVay of Green Acres, WA, and mother-in-law, Earlane Bateman of Clifton and other relatives. Visitation was held on Saturday, September 2 at Crain Funeral Home in Franklinton. Family hours was from 5:00 until 6:00 p.m. with Masonic Rites at 7:00 p.m. and public visitation from 6-9 p.m. and on Sunday from 12:00 until 2:00 p.m. A funeral service was held in the funeral home chapel at 2:00 in the afternoon, with burial following in Ellis Cemetery in Franklinton. Mr. Nelson’s death came as the Era-Leader went to press early due to the Monday holiday. He was a special friend of our staff. A complete obituary will be published in next week’s newspaper.
